negative punishment
The Mosby Medical Encyclopedia 10-01-1996 negative punishment, a form of behavior modification in which removing something after a certain behavior occurs decreases the probability that the behavior will occur again. The ideas, procedures and suggestions contained in this encyclopedia are not ...
